gallivm: handle texel swizzles correctly for d3d10-style sample opcodes
unlike OpenGL, the texel swizzle is embedded in the instruction, so honor that. (Technically we now execute both the sampler_view swizzle and the per-instruction swizzle but this should be quite ok.) v2: add documentation note as it's not obvious. Reviewed-by: Jose Fonseca <jfonseca@vmware.com>
